The U.S. Department of Homeland Security shutdown, which took effect early Saturday, is affecting the agency responsible for screening passengers and bags at airports across the country. Travelers with nervous flight reservations may remember 43 days Government shutdown Which led to historic flight cancellations and long delays last year.
Transportation Security Administration The officers are expected to work without pay while lawmakers remain without an agreement on annual funding for the Department of Homeland Security. TSA officers also worked during the record shutdown period that ended Nov. 12, but aviation experts say this may be different.
However, U.S. travel industry trade groups and major airlines have warned that the longer DHS allocations lapse, the longer security lines at the nation’s commercial airports will grow.

Homeland security funding It ended at midnight. But the rest of the federal government is funded through September 30. This means that air traffic controllers working for the FAA will receive their pay as usual, reducing the risk of widespread flight cancellations.
According to the department’s emergency plan, about 95% of TSA workers are considered essential employees and are required to continue working. Democrats in the House and Senate say the Department of Homeland Security will not receive funding until new restrictions are imposed on federal immigration operations.
During previous lockdowns, disruptions to air travel tended to occur more Build over timeAnd not overnight. For example, about a month after last year’s shutdown, the TSA temporarily closed two checkpoints at Philadelphia International Airport. On the same day, the government Take the extraordinary step Requesting all commercial airlines to reduce their domestic flight schedules.
John Rose, chief risk officer at global travel management company Altour, said tensions may emerge at airports more quickly this time around because the TSA workforce will also remember the recent closure.
“It’s still fresh in their minds and probably in their pockets,” Rose said.
It is difficult to predict if, when, or where security check snags may appear. Even a few unscheduled TSA absences can quickly lead to longer wait times at small airports, for example, if there is only one security checkpoint.
This is why travelers should plan to arrive early and allow extra time to pass through security checkpoints.
“I tell people to do this even in the good times,” Rose said.
Experts say flight delays are also possible although air traffic controllers are not affected by the Department of Homeland Security shutdown.
Rich Davis, senior security consultant at risk mitigation firm International SOS, said airlines may decide to delay departing flights in some cases to wait for passengers to finish screening. A shortage of TSA officers can also slow down the screening of checked baggage behind the scenes.
Most airports display security line wait times on their websites, but don’t wait until the day of your flight to check them, Rose advised.
“You might look online and you’ll find two-and-a-half hours,” he said. “It’s now two and a half hours before your flight and you haven’t left for the airport yet.”
Passengers should also pay close attention while packing since prohibited items will likely lengthen the screening process. For carry-on luggage, avoid bringing full-sized shampoo or other liquids, gels or large sprays and items like pocket knives in carry-on luggage.
TSA He has a complete list On its website what is and is not allowed in carry-on baggage and checked baggage.
At the airport, Rose said, remember to “be patient and compassionate.”
“Not only are they not getting paid, they are probably short-staffed and dealing with angry travelers,” he said of the TSA agents.
The White House is negotiating with Democratic lawmakers, but the two sides failed to reach an agreement by the end of the week before senators and congressmen leave Washington for a 10-day vacation.
However, lawmakers in both chambers were aware of a return if a deal was reached to end the lockdown.
Democrats said they wouldn’t help approve even more funding for Homeland Security New restrictions They were placed in federal immigration operations after the fatal shooting of Alex Pretty and Rene is good In Minneapolis last month.
In a joint statement, US Travel, Airlines for America and American Hotel & The housing association warned that the closure threatens to disrupt air travel as the busy spring break travel season approaches.
“Travelers and the U.S. economy cannot afford to operate essential TSA employees without pay, which increases the risk of unscheduled absences and call-outs, and can ultimately lead to longer wait times and missed or delayed flights,” the statement read.
